Stromal vascular fraction (SVF) cells are a heterogeneous collection of non-adipocyte cells obtained from adipose tissue through enzymatic digestion or mechanical dissociation (Source: PubMed 27014503). This population includes adipose-derived stem cells (ADSCs), endothelial progenitor cells, pericytes, fibroblasts, and various immune cells such as macrophages and lymphocytes (Source: PubMed 30631533). SVF is not a single molecular target like a receptor or enzyme; rather, it is a therapeutic cellular product used in regenerative medicine (Source: PubMed 31133587). Its biological function involves the secretion of pro-angiogenic and anti-inflammatory factors, which facilitate tissue repair and modulate the immune response (Source: PubMed 28210533). Clinically, SVF is applied in treating conditions such as osteoarthritis, chronic wounds, and ischemic diseases, where it promotes healing through paracrine mechanisms and potential differentiation (Source: NIH/StatPearls). Despite its therapeutic potential, SVF faces challenges regarding the lack of standardized isolation protocols and the inherent variability of cell composition between donors (Source: PubMed 30631533).
